Nutrition Facts for Mediterranean diet classic homemade meatballs

Mediterranean Diet Classic Homemade Meatballs

Image of Mediterranean Diet Classic Homemade Meatballs
Nutriscore Rating: 64/100

Elevate your weeknight dinners with these Mediterranean Diet Classic Homemade Meatballs, a flavorful twist on a comforting favorite. Crafted with a blend of lean ground beef and lamb, these tender meatballs are infused with aromatic herbs like fresh parsley and mint, along with warm spices such as cumin and cinnamon for a distinctive Mediterranean flair. Parmesan cheese and breadcrumbs provide the perfect texture, while a rich, homemade tomato sauce ties it all together. Quick to prepare in under an hour, these meatballs are ideal for serving over rice, couscous, or as part of a vibrant mezze platter. Packed with protein and Mediterranean-inspired flavor, this wholesome recipe will become a family favorite for healthy eating with delicious results.

Log this recipe in SnapCalorie

★★★★★ 4.8/5.0 (2,000+ reviews)
Get your calorie requirement
Log your nutrition in seconds
Get a personalized nutrition plan
SnapCalorie App Screenshot

Recipe Information

⏱️
Prep Time
20 min
🔥
Cook Time
25 min
🕐
Total Time
45 min
👥
Servings
6 servings
📊
Difficulty
Medium

🥘 Ingredients

14 items
  • 500 grams Lean ground beef
  • 250 grams Ground lamb
  • 1 large Egg
  • 60 grams Breadcrumbs
  • 30 grams Grated Parmesan cheese
  • 2 large Garlic cloves, minced
  • 30 grams Fresh parsley, finely chopped
  • 10 grams Fresh mint, finely chopped
  • 1 teaspoon Salt
  • 0.5 teaspoon Black pepper
  • 1 teaspoon Ground cumin
  • 0.25 teaspoon Ground cinnamon
  • 2 tablespoons Olive oil
  • 400 grams Tomato sauce
💡
Pro Tip: Read through all ingredients before starting to cook!

📝 Instructions

7 steps
1

In a large mixing bowl, combine the ground beef and lamb, egg, breadcrumbs, Parmesan cheese, minced garlic, chopped parsley, chopped mint, salt, black pepper, cumin, and cinnamon. Mix all the ingredients thoroughly using your hands to ensure even distribution of spices.

2

Shape the mixture into small meatballs, about 1.5 inches in diameter. You should get approximately 24 meatballs.

3

Heat the olive oil in a large skillet over medium heat. Once the oil is hot, add the meatballs in batches, being careful not to overcrowd the pan.

4

Brown the meatballs on all sides, which should take about 5 minutes per batch. Once browned, remove the meatballs from the pan and set them aside on a plate.

5

After all meatballs are browned, pour the tomato sauce into the skillet. Scrape up any browned bits from the bottom of the pan for extra flavor.

6

Return all the meatballs to the skillet with the tomato sauce. Lower the heat to a simmer and cook for an additional 10-15 minutes, turning the meatballs occasionally until they are fully cooked and the sauce has slightly thickened.

7

Serve warm. These meatballs are perfect as part of a mezze platter or served over a bed of rice or with a side of couscous.

Cooking Tip: Take your time with each step for the best results!
2341
cal
197.3g
protein
69.4g
carbs
139.8g
fat

Nutrition Facts

1 serving (1384.1g)
Calories
2341
% Daily Value*
Total Fat 139.8 g 179%
Saturated Fat 49.7 g 249%
Polyunsaturated Fat 8.1 g
Cholesterol 799 mg 266%
Sodium 5769 mg 251%
Total Carbohydrate 69.4 g 25%
Dietary Fiber 8.4 g 30%
Total Sugars 13.2 g
Protein 197.3 g 395%
Vitamin D 1.6 mcg 8%
Calcium 614 mg 47%
Iron 25.7 mg 143%
Potassium 1322 mg 28%

*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

11.9%%
33.9%%
54.1%%
Fat: 1258 cal (54.1%%)
Protein: 789 cal (33.9%%)
Carbs: 277 cal (11.9%%)